Designer Dolls, Inc. found that the number N of dolls sold varies directly with their advertising budget A and inversely with th
Travka [436]

Answer:

D


Step-by-step explanation:

Direct Variation takes the form  A = kB  

Inverse Variation takes the form  A=k(\frac{1}{B})

  • Where A and B are the 2 variables associated and k is the proportionality constant.

<em>Since </em><em>number of dolls [N] </em><em>varies </em><em>directly </em><em>with </em><em>advertising budget [A],</em><em> in our equation, </em><em>A should go in the numerator</em><em> and since </em><em>number of dolls [N] </em><em>varies </em><em>inversely</em><em> with </em><em>price of dolls [P]</em><em>, </em><em>P should go in the denominator.</em>

Thus we can write our equation as:

N=k(\frac{A}{P})

Solving this equation for k given the information "The company sold 5200 dolls when $26,000 was spent on advertising and the price of a doll was set at $30":

N=k(\frac{A}{P})\\5200=k(\frac{26,000}{30})\\5200=k(866.67)\\k=\frac{5200}{866.67}=5.99

Rounding k=5.99 to k=6


Now, given that we want to find the number of dolls [N] when A=52,000  and  P=30 , we have:

N=(6)(\frac{52,000}{30})\\N=10,400 dolls

Answer choice D is correct.
